Here are the ones I'm most excited about over the next few weeks:

  • Star Trek. Now this is from a person who has never seen a Star Trek movie before, but the preview really got me.
  • Angels and Demons. I liked The Da Vinci Code more than I expected, Tom Hanks is great, Ron Howard is great, the book was great.
  • The Brothers Bloom. I doubt many have heard of this one, but I saw a preview for it a long time ago, and thought it looked terrific.
  • Terminator 4: Salvation. Christian Bale, in a post-apocalyptic technology thriller. Yes, please.
  • Year One. Comedy with Jack Black and Michael Cera, in the year 1 AD. Commercials look funny, I'll be keeping an eye on it.
  • Public Enemies. This is the one I'm looking forward to most, Johnny Depp and Christian Bale in a Michael Mann film about the bank robber John Dillinger. This has world class potential!
  • Harry Potter 6. Guaranteed, I would think.
  • Funny People. A sweet looking comedy/drama with Adam Sandler and Seth Rogan.
